Edera is a container-native Type-1 hypervisor that eliminates the trade-off between container security and performance. It isolates every workload in its own lightweight “zone,” preventing container escapes by design while maintaining near-native speed and full Kubernetes compatibility.
Traditional containers share the same Linux kernel, which creates risk of container escapes and lateral movement. Edera replaces that shared foundation with per-container micro-VMs, providing complete workload isolation. This design blocks privilege-escalation attacks and zero-days that exploit the kernel — without needing new tooling or specialized hardware.
